wdmMeanChannelPowerControlAdminStatus

LUM-WDM-MIB · .1.3.6.1.4.1.8708.2.4.2.15.1.1.11

Object

The administrative state for the local link
adjustment entry.
              
down - The link adjustment is disabled
              
service - The link is adjusting the channel
power but alarms are suppressed.
Intended for use during service or
re-configuration. When service is concluded
adminStatus should be set to 'up' again.
              
up - The link adjustment is active.
Regulations will be performed regularly and
on user orders. Alarms are not suppressed.
